Culture Notes from Donor: Parent plant: Temperature range CI (58-75°F)
Comments: Parent plant: In Thesaurus Masdevalliaceum, C. Luer provides the etymology for this species: "From the Latin anfractus, 'crooked, oblique, slanting,' referring to the lower part of the synsepalum, which is distinctly oblique in all known clones."
Although the imaged flowers don't exhibit the anfractous synsepalum, the flowers
otherwise conform perfectly to the plant illustration, description, and diagnostic line drawings in Thesaurus Masdevalliaceum.

About the name...
Etymology of |
anfracta |
|
From Latin "anfractus" bent, crooked.
(Source:
Mayr & Schmucker 1998) |
Etymology of |
Masdevallia |
|
Named for José Masdeval, physician in the court of Spain.
(Source:
Pridgeon 1992) |
Pronunciation of |
Masdevallia |
|
maz-de-VAH-lee-ah
(Source:
Hawkes 1978) |
